Modular and extensible skins, e. Reliable. A jQuery plugin that adds cross-browser mouse wheel support. A jQuery plugin that adds cross-browser mouse wheel support with delta normalization. min. 5. eslintrc. Demo Download. In case id is an array, it will contain multiple elements. Try refreshing the page a few times. bind, . When an AJAX call is made and this component is updated, the DOM element is replaced with the newly rendered content. 0 for standard 'click', usually left button. And you can pass this event to your element by doing so :I'm using Framework7 sortable list and it works well, just that it doesn't trigger an event when the list is changed. Each scroll causes your page to jump and then each jump results in the "jumpy" jittery animation as the background image is trying to position itself at these jumps. 3. Start using magnificent in your project by running `npm i magnificent`. 3. * Allows unlimited hours. For what it sounds like you're trying to do, you need to use a more specific selector, catch the scroll, read the direction and distance, and prevent default so it doesn't scroll the window - $ ('img'). Notes: In versions of Firefox where both the wheel and DOMMouseScroll events are supported, we need a way to instruct the browser to execute only wheel and not both. But I am not able (and did not find any resources) to configure it the way I want. scroll to next divs on mousewheel jQuery. // Typical deltaY values from a trackpad pinch are under 1. The WheelEvent interface represents events that occur due to the user moving a mouse wheel or similar input device. addEventListener(イベント名,リスナー,[オプション])イベントリスナーの削除removeEventListener…The Neat Scrollbar module comes with the option to apply vertical scrollbars to side-wide content such as all nodes or all blocks. Viewed 11k times 3 Trying to create a parallax page and on each mousewheel, page would scroll to next div (block) I tried with the following code but no luck, can anyone please suggest. mousewheel. originalEvent. 4, last published: 3 years ago. 33. In addition there is a new property on the event object. jQuery Plugin for Mouse Wheel Support - MouseWheel 04/01/2021 - Other - 29639 Views. For instance, Markdown is designed to be easier to write. 2 Answers. Trying to trigger scroll event by using jquery. It just so happens that JQuery UI’s spinner is also listening for mousewheel events. Jquery Find if Event is a scrollbar click. メモ: wheel イベントと scroll イベントを混同しないで. It applies to window objects, but also. cloudflare. To fix the issue you can set passive: false when you bind the event handler: window. When that input fires, if it’s an “up” mousewheel scroll, we’ll increment the value upwards one, if “down”, it will be decremented by one (unless it’s already zero). jquery-mousewheel. 1. mousewheel (function (event, delta) { this. blur(); The first two approaches both stop the window from scrolling and the last removes focus from the element; both of which are undesirable outcomes. A jQuery plugin that adds cross-browser mouse wheel support. js. “MouseWheel Smooth Scroll” is open source software. bind mousemove() with click event. I believe you can make it. It's a plugin to create the parallax effect. Just search 'mousewheel' and you can find a function called 'scroll'. e. Fix version number for package managers… 3. jQuery Mousewheel. travel. . trigger('click'); I need something like that just with an scrollwheel Mousewheel event. 2. 1. The combination of these three make this a rather useless metric to do anything useful with. It is adapted out of frustration of turning the slider example of a horizontal scrollbar into a vertical scrollbar. With a combination of versatility and extensibility, jQuery has changed the way that. 本堂課主要是延續上一篇 jQuery學習. Mousewheel event jquery. イベントリスナーイベントリスナーの追加イベントターゲット. A jQuery plugin that adds cross-browser mouse wheel support with delta normalization. 2 ; Fixed pageX, pageY, clientX and clientY event properties for Mozilla. 2,155 5 5 gold badges 29 29 silver badges 53 53 bronze badges. Problems with mousewheel in jQuery. . I'm using a mousewheel / wheel event to zoom in/out on my page. unbind and . To enable horizontal scrolling (and disable vertical scrolling), paste the following code at the end of assets/js/in5. originalEvent. . Enable the smooth scrolling effect on the whole page. This number has the potential to be in the thousands depending on the device. The basic idea is to collect all the sections and animate the scroll between their offsets on the mouse wheel event. currently i’m developing a horizontal scroll mousewheel in website that can enable my mouse scroll to scroll to the left and right. on("mousewheel DOMMouseScroll", functionName) jQuery handler, it runs smoothly and everything works fine, event. Unable to preventDefault inside passive event listener due to target being treated as passive. jquery-mousewheel. jquery. TouchNSwipe is a responsive, flexible and easy to setup jQuery gallery plugin for mobile and desktop that supports touch gestures such as pinch to zoom, drag and swipe. Asset Type. 0. 2. . The scroll event is sent to an element when the user scrolls to a different place in the element. 1. まとめ:JavaScriptでスロットゲームをプログラム解説. jquery animated horizontal scroll on mouse scroll event. scrollTop () and save the value between scroll events, then get the delta at next scroll event. . Mouse Wheel Event and Scroll Event conflicting with eachother. mousewheel. Reason being each mouse wheel scroll doesn't scroll the content by a certain amount of pixels. This kind of cancellation seems to be ignored in newer Chrome >18 Browsers (and perhaps other WebKit based Browsers). Is it possible to . Oh, and one more thing: What if we need scrolling inside the modal? We still have to trigger a response for a touch event. bind ('mousewheel DOMMouseScroll', function (e) { return false; }); The. To achieve this, upon button click, we’ll first override the page’s scroll behavior by setting scroll-behavior: auto, and then after navigating to the top of the page, we’ll set it back to smooth. 2. This code only detect down movement (that means negative delta). 0. mousewheel (function (event, delta) { //Trigger slide event //Prevent the default mouse wheel event. any one pls help me put on this. For the deprecated . When the behavior is triggered, the configured JavaScript gets executed. md","path":"README. js created by Brandon Aaron. 2+ ; You can now treat mousewheel as a normal event and use . bind ('mousewheel DOMMouseScroll', function (event) { return false}); If you want to prevent scrolling with mouse wheel in a single DOM element, try this: $ ('# {element-id}'). . Package jquery-mousewheel failed to load. 12: Jul 10 2014: 3. Demo Download. Next, you will find another two ways to zoom in and out. creating a new release due to plugins. Contribute to xdan/datetimepicker development by creating an account on GitHub. on ( 'click', '. Hot Network Questions Pass result of find command as another command's multiple optionsWhen the DOM is ready, we’ll bind the new “mousewheel” event to the input. Link to plugin GitHub page SetupFind Jquery Mousewheel Examples and Templates. jquery vertical mousewheel smooth scrolling. GitHub. How to do a horizontal scroll on mouse wheel scroll? 4. Viewed 7k times 2 I need to pass a variable inside a "bind mouse wheel" function and trigger that function when a user clicks on a link. 귀찮으신 분들을 위해 파일을 올려둘게요. Old versions of browsers implemented the non-standard and non-cross-browser-compatible MouseWheelEvent and MouseScrollEvent interfaces. 2+ ; You can now treat mousewheel as a normal event and use . unbind and . css b/core/assets/vendor/select2/select2. A jQuery plugin that adds cross-browser mouse wheel support with delta normalization. Note that this doesn't work on Firefox, but the method can easily be applied to jQuery mousewheel plugin. Modified 6 years, 6 months ago. 0. < element onwheel=" myScript "> 尝试一下. I'm using Jquery mousewheel plugin and I would like like to be able to detect when the user has finished using the wheel. getLineHeight(this)); $. To interact with the calendar, use the methods of this widget, or for more advanced usages, use the datePicker JQueryUI widget plugin, for example: PF. import { defineConfig } from 'vite' import RubyPlugin from 'vite-plugin-ruby' + import inject from "@rollup/plugin-inject"; export default defineConfig({ plugins. Description. wheelDelta in mousewheel event handler is about -40*e. Learn more about TeamsjQuery Plugin Date and Time Picker. frontend development by creating an account on GitHub. Zoom responsively. trigger ; Using jQuery. It supports panning and zooming images, text, video s, divs and many other html elements. gitignore. unbind and . body. A positive value indicates that the wheel button has rotated away from the user. EDIT: Since Chrome 73 it is required to mark the event listener for the mousewheel event as non-passive in order to be able to call preventDefault() on it. 1. In order to use the plugin, simply bind the mousewheel event to an element. 2 ; Fixed pageX, pageY, clientX and clientY event properties for. When I call it with el. 1. json. 3 ; Include MozMousePixelScroll in the to fix list to avoid inconsistent behavior in older Firefox 3. The answer is YES, you can. on ("DOMMouseScroll mousewheel wheel", _methods. It's easy to customize options. creating a new release due to plugins. It has been used for many years in a wide variety of jQuery plugins, websites and web applications. Sadly the site I am building is using bootstrap 4 which means I cannot use juqery mobile since BS4 uses jquery 3 which does not support jquery mobile. Bad release. Note: Don't confuse the wheel event with the scroll event. Inherited from BaseWidget. 2. trigger ; Using jQuery. 0. jQuery mouse wheel horizontally. And if we spin the. // Store the line height and page height for this particular element $. The big caveat is that not all legacy browsers support them, Mozilla only recently. js plugin, and I'd like to decide, if user scrolls down, then the content should fade out, and the user should see the next section. . When you execute this. Adds mouse wheel support for your application! Just call mousewheel to add the event and call unmousewheel to remove the event. npm install --save jquery npm install --save @types/jquery After successful installation you will see a folder inside the node_modules/@types with jQuery type defination files. preventDefault (); // do some stuff });Dec 16, 2014 at 20:06. If i scroll 2 times down then value will be 2 and then. 7+, the detail property is not available at the jQuery Event object. Just CSS. 2. That would mean that if you trigger it (without a mouse), you’d still be able to do stuff with it. com issue :( 3. 4k. 4 ; Always set the deltaY ; Add back in the deltaX and deltaY support for older Firefox versions 3. mousewheel is not part of the jQuery API. I have tried this code and the result is always negative:For a different question I composed this answer, including this sample code. deltaX. To fix the issue you can set passive: false when you bind the event handler: window. Find Jquery Mousewheel Examples and Templates. 2. 4, last published: 3 years ago. You only need one swiper-wrapper div that wraps all your slides.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. com issue :( 3. mousewheel. A negative value indicates that the wheel button has rotated toward the user. Mouse Wheel plugin is here. It's ideal for prototyping ideas or trying out new libraries. bind, . A jQuery plugin that adds cross-browser mouse wheel support with delta normalization. delay(5). com issue :( 3. mousewheel event not working on firefox. If you have questions about Swiper ask them in StackOverflow or Swiper Discussions. mousewheel. jquery-mousewheel. It makes things like HTML document traversal and manipulation, event handling, animation, and Ajax much simpler with an easy-to-use API that works across a multitude of browsers. unbind and . Here's how I did it to retain the scroll position with jquery: js const currPageScrollPos = $(window). jQuery scroll to a certain point using mouse wheel. They used jquery. It also provides two helper methods called mousewheel and unmousewheel that act just like other event helper methods in jQuery. $(window). 1. HTML CSS JS Behavior Editor HTML. For example: For example: index. bind, . In order to use the plugin, simply bind the mousewheel event to an element. Please note that some widgets have got not DOM elements at all, in this case this will be an empty jQuery instance. In the demo above, each time you scrolled on a page, all. data API for expandos 2. 1. Features include vertical and/or horizontal scrollbar(s), adjustable scrolling momentum, mouse-wheel (via jQuery mousewheel plugin), keyboard and touch support, ready-to-use themes and customization via CSS, RTL direction support, option parameters for full control of scrollbar. The issue is that even though I have the e. 0. There are no other projects in the npm registry using magnificent. 2. 2 ; Fixed pageX, pageY, clientX and clientY event properties for. 0. Drag to pan. mCustomScrollbar. 12. About External Resources. preventDefault (); }); With DivName probably being your slider and I believe Delta is the scroll direction (in units) So I would guess. 2. 3. Zoom Image Point With Mouse Wheel. First, we need to create three files index. html (), . mousewheel. on() method is the preferred method for attaching event handlers to a document). hammer. jquery. jQuery UI is a curated set of user interface interactions, effects, widgets, and themes built on top of the jQuery JavaScript Library. detail always returns 0. bind, . $(document). There might be a problem with your internet connection. 9. To have height and width into a variable (JQuery)Debounce mouse wheel. 2 ; Include grunt utilities for development purposes (jshint and uglify) ; Include support for browserify ; Some basic cleaning up 3. Mouse Events in jQuery: mouseenter and mouseleave. I'm using Jquery mousewheel plugin and I would like like to be able to detect when the user has finished using the wheel. How to take control of mousewheel scroll before it happens? 0. The last one is IE, and is the only one you're not listening for. onwheel=function () { myScript }; 尝试一下. indicating the scrolling direction of the mouse wheel:. and also i can scroll image with mouse. Here’s the required code: 1. Check 'mousewheel' event direction with scroll locked. In order to use the plugin, simply bind the mousewheel event to an element. deltaY read-only property is a double representing the vertical scroll amount in the WheelEvent. g. How can I disable those 9 events and only handle it once. the convert the template js to a method. 1. imgViewer is a simple and flexible jQuery plugin that allows to zoom in and out an image with mousewheel or drag it with mouse click. <p>. Without it, the browser will do a full page zoom ev. Horizontal scroll on mousewheel. gitignore","path":". preventDefault (); // Prevent user scroll during page jump }, { passive: false }); WheelEvent. Please read tag info before adding it. 5% of all websites, serving over 200 billion requests each month, powered by Cloudflare. In my case, it raises the event 10 times when I scroll the mouse wheel once. MarsOne. 4. The plugin that @DarinDimitrov posted, jquery-mousewheel, is broken with jQuery 3+. scrollTop() $("body"). This code only detect down movement (that means negative delta). Bad release. addEventListener ("mousewheel", mousewheel, false); // chrome window. 2+ ; You can now treat mousewheel as a normal event and use . Consider marking event handler as 'passive' to make the page more responive. jQuery Mousewheel. About External Resources. 0. In that code I use the mouse wheel to zoom in/out of an HTML5 Canvas. com issue :( 3. Does anyone have experience with this and can offer some pointers. 2 ; Fixed pageX, pageY, clientX and clientY event properties for Mozilla. The mCustomScrollbar plugin is provided together with various other example files. 本堂課主要是延續上一篇 jQuery學習. detail in DOMMouseScroll event handler. 9k. Consider marking event handler as 'passive' to make the page more responsive. htmlmousewheel. addEventListener ('wheel', function (e) { e. That would explain why Windows or the browser doesn't seem to normalise the mousewheel event values itself (and might mean you cannot write reliable code to normalise the values). removeClass(document. Shift-click to zoom out. mousewheel (function. jquery animate on scroll position. First, we’ll need to attach the click event to it: $ ( document ). 2. Supports images, videos, maps, inline content, iframes and any other HTML content. In the comments of the js file I see the following update just a couple of months ago // 2. auto-detects browser rendering capabilities. js를 다운받아서 , 스크립트 위치에 삽입해줍니다. 1. gitignore. 10. Bad release. Latest version: 3. 5f, wheel); //. 0 ; Uses new special events API in jQuery 1. 0. preventDefault (); line, a funny thing happens. 0. com issue :( 3. In that case, loop through each tag beginning with the first, until its first. add the controller name to ur index body. cdnjs is a free and open-source CDN service trusted by over 12. wheelDelta); } 取得したイベント情報は指定したイベント変数に 「wheelDelta」 として格納されます。. 3. com Home. 1. In your Javascript file, create a jQuery instance of the carousel’s 'swiper-container' element using the ID/class you chose and the 'swiper-container' class (replace #my-id with your ID/class): 5. To Reproduc. 3 ; Include MozMousePixelScroll in the to fix list to avoid inconsistent behavior in older Firefox 3. The official jQuery mousewheel plugin that adds cross-browser mouse wheel support to your web projects. Ask Question Asked 7 years, 1 month ago. 注意: Internet Explorer 8 及更早 IE 版本不支持 addEventListener () 方法. 2 ; Fixed pageX, pageY, clientX and clientY event properties for Mozilla. If the problem persists, file an issue on GitHub. Use this online jquery-mousewheel playground to view and fork jquery-mousewheel example apps and templates on CodeSandbox. You can apply CSS to your Pen from any stylesheet on the web. Bind Mouse Wheel To Jquery UI Slider. mousewheel. But you can use the regular addEventListener for this. MyPanel. jquery mousewheel. How to count mouse scroll in jquery/javascript? Like initial value 0 and scroll down ++1 and scroll up --1. Every "alt" value corresponds to the swiper index number (starting at 0). Even if the spinner element is not in focus or selected, and the mouse cursor is over the element, the spin element will detect the mousewheel event. click ( function () {. 3 and before 3.